Greatest Moments in the Summer Olympics by Matt ~ His world record stands today because the 60-meter event was cut from the Olympics after the 1904 Games. Two decades later, at the 1924 Games in Paris, France, Harold Abrahams of Great Britain perfected his stride by laying pieces of paper on the ground where he wanted his feet to fall.

Top Ten Summer Olympic Games - Gunaxin ~ Since 1896, the Summer Olympics have been hosted once every four years by amazing cities like Athens, Greece and Paris, France. Over the past 120 years, we have witnessed some of the most amazing sports moments once every four years except during World War I and World War II when the 1916, 1940, and 1944 Olympics were cancelled, and they were never a disappointment.

A flame, a look, one of the Olympics' most powerful moments ~ ATLANTA (AP) — EDITORS — With the Tokyo Olympics postponed for a year because of the coronavirus pandemic, The Associated Press is looking back at the history of Summer Games. Here are some of the highlights of the 1996 Atlanta Games, where Muhammad Ali provided the greatest moment before the competition even began.

1964 - Wikipedia ~ October 10–24 – The 1964 Summer Olympics are held in Tokyo, Japan, the first in an Asian country. October 12 – The Soviet Union launches Voskhod 1 into Earth orbit as the first spacecraft with a multi-person crew and the first flight without space suits. The flight is cut short and lands again on October 13 after 16 orbits.
